#4f1d8e basic color information

#4f1d8e

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#4f1d8e has decimal index of: 5184910, is composed of 31% red, 11.4% green and 55.7% blue. #4f1d8e in CMYK color model, is composed of 44.4% cyan, 79.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black.
#663399 is the closest web-safe color to #4f1d8e.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
